Humans& Launches Long-Horizon Multi-Agent Models

Humans& is a San Francisco startup that launched three months ago to build AI systems meant to augment workers, featuring long-horizon and multi-agent reinforcement learning as core capabilities. The seed round raised $480 million led by SV Angel and Georges Harik, with participation from Nvidia, Google Ventures, Jeff Bezos and others, and the team includes hires from Anthropic, xAI and Google.

The company described itself as a "human-centric frontier lab" and signaled technical focuses on memory, user understanding and agents that coordinate with people and other models. Its website and statements highlighted plans for a first product due later this year and emphasized training approaches that prioritize sustained planning and interactive feedback loops.
